Apple is facing increasing demands to do more for Iranian protestors

read original related products more articles

As Starlink becomes a lifeline to Iranian protestors, some are calling on Apple to expand access to satellite-based texting. As protests in Iran intensify, satellite technology has become one of the only ways for people in the country to circumvent a total internet blackout and heavy restrictions on phone service. Now, as a number of people in the country turn to SpaceX—the company now providing free access to Starlink—there are growing calls for Apple to get involved, too.
